    i'm sure your'e all aware of the scene that didnt make it into the original Star Wars: A New Hope, the Han meets Jabba bit, which was stuck into the recent remastered versions. But theres also stacks of other ones that never made it. I was reading the script the other night and i noticed that there was several scenes with Luke that werent in the film.

    Luke sees the battle in orbit over Tatooine with his macrobinoculars while repairing a vaporator (the first scene in which he appears actually).

    Luke and his friends meeting in Tosche station, and Luke saying goodbye to Biggs, whos going off to join the Rebels.

    I would have brushed these off as scenes that just werent filmed, but I have actually seen pictures of them in some old Star Wars annuals. Has anybody got any idea what actually happend to these scenes, and why they appear to have been all but forgotten?

    Mention of restored scenes etc. raises an old objection I had to one scene restored in A New Hope for the remasters.
    The one where Han is seen to actually return fire under the table in the bar at mos eisly. According to Lord Lucas he thought the original scene made Han look too nasty and wanted to protect the loveable rogue image by making it look as if he had returned fires in self defence.
    In my opinion this was total crap. It just looks stupid. I mean if the bad guy fired first under the table at a distance of 2 feet he would not miss. The loveable rogue was never in any danger. Han was a cool dood who killed first, asked questions later and we laughed it all up. Now he's a goody two-shoes. I mean please!
